Peabody Energy Corp 2021 SR

The report highlights Peabody's commitment to achieving net-zero emissions by 2050, with an interim target of a 15% reduction in Scope 1 and 2 emissions by 2026. In 2021, the company achieved its lowest recordable injury rate in over a decade and restored approximately 2,400 acres of land. Peabody also announced a joint venture, R3 Renewables, to develop solar and battery storage projects on former mining sites. The company continues to align its reporting with GRI, SASB, and TCFD frameworks while maintaining its status as a UN Global Compact signatory.
